Southern Co. Stock Falls Friday, Still Outperforms Market
This article was automatically generated by MarketWatch using technology from Automated Insights.
Shares of Southern Co. (SO) shed 0.28% to $64.56 Friday, on what proved to be an all-around rough trading session for the stock market, with the S&P 500 Index falling 1.05% to 3,970.04 and Dow Jones Industrial Average falling 1.02% to 32,816.92. This was the stock's fourth consecutive day of losses. Southern Co. closed $16.01 short of its 52-week high ($80.57), which the company reached on August 19th.
The stock demonstrated a mixed performance when compared to some of its competitors Friday, as NextEra Energy Inc. (NEE) rose 0.07% to $72.92, Dominion Energy Inc. (D) fell 0.51% to $57.00, and American Electric Power Co. Inc. (AEP) fell 0.31% to $90.43. Trading volume (5.5 M) eclipsed its 50-day average volume of 4.2 M.
